The following Uniform Building Code and San Joaquin Ordinance <br /> requirement will be applicable and shall be incorporated in <br /> the construction plans before submittal to the Building <br /> Inspection Division: <br /> a. Provide restrooms conforming with all disabled access <br /> requirements (C.A.C. , Title 24 ) . <br /> 2 . A grading plan shall be submitted and approved and a grading <br /> permit issued by the Building Inspection Division prior to per- <br /> forming any excavation or filling of earth material: <br /> a. A grading plan shall contain the information listed in <br /> the U .B.C. , Appendix, Chapter 70 , Section 7006 ( 1 ) . <br /> b. The grading plan shall include complete drainage details <br /> and elevations of the adjacent parcels . Retaining wall <br /> details shall be submitted where applicable. <br /> C. Grading in excess of 5 , 000 cubic yards shall comply with <br /> Section 7014 for "Engineered Grading Requirements" . <br /> d. All recommendations of the soils engineer shall be incor- <br /> porated in the grading plans . <br /> e. All compaction reports must be submitted prior to a foun- <br /> dation inspection . <br />
